方法一:使用列表推导式 列表推导式是Python中一种简洁而强大的语法,可以方便地生成新列表。你可以使用列表推导式将一维列表转换为二维列表。 python def convert_to_2d_list(one_d_list, num_columns): return [[one_d_list[i * num_columns + j] for j in range(num_columns)] for i in range(len(on...
在Python中,用于将两个一维列表转换为二维列表的方法是zip()。zip()函数接受两个或更多的迭代对象(例如列表)作为参数,然后创建一个新的迭代器,它生成由每个迭代对象的相应元素组成的元组。例如,如果有两个列表list1和list2,zip(list1,list2)将生成一个新的迭代器,其每个元素是一个元组,包含来自list1和list2的...
1.转置:如果你想将一维列表转换为行,每个元素都是一个行,可以使用列表推导式。 ```python 原始一维列表 lst = [1, 2, 3, 4, 5] 转置为二维列表 lst_2d = [lst[i:i+2] for i in range(0, len(lst), 2)] print(lst_2d)输出: [[1, 2], [3, 4],[5]] ``` 2.转换为列:如果你想将...
#将一维列表转为二维列表,每行元素个数为nn = 3one_dim_list= [1, 2, 3, 4, 5, 6, 7, 8, 9] two_dim_list= [one_dim_list[i:i+n]foriinrange(0, len(one_dim_list), n)]print(two_dim_list)#输出:[[1, 2, 3], [4, 5, 6], [7, 8, 9]]...
python 一维array python 一维列表转二维 吞一块大饼,还不如切成小块吃得香 常见的数据集,要么是数列,要么是表格; 因此,数据分析最首要的是,处理一维、二维数据。 主要知识点可参考如图。 如需要,可点击以下百度网盘链接下载数据分析基础知识图PDF: mindmap2_数据分析基础.pdf...
列表可修改 #一维数组 list = ['Denny','Jenny','Liming','Lilei','Hanmeimei'] #多维数组 #二维数组 list1=[1,2,3,4,[51,52,53,54],6,,78] #三维数组 list2=[1,2,3,4,[xiaoming[18,175],xiaola# 列list = ['吉娃娃1','吉娃娃2','吉娃娃3','吉娃娃4'] ...
一、mxnet安装 (以下均为mac环境) 有二种方式: 1.1 用conda安装 1 #创建gluon目录 2 mkdir ...
再用 编辑 ->选择性粘贴 在对话框中勾选“转置”项 确定就会把列转为行了,如果复制的行也会转成...
python二维列表一维列表的互相转换实例 python⼆维列表⼀维列表的互相转换实例 ⼆维列表转⼀维列表 from compiler.ast import flatten a=[[1,2],[5,6]]print(flatten(a))结果:[1, 2, 5, 6]⼀维列表转⼆维列表 a=[1,2,5,6]b=[3,4,8,9]print(zip(a,b))结果: [(1, 3), (2, ...
将以下二维列表变为一维列表。 nums=[[1,2,3],[4,5,6],[7,8,9]] 一、列表生成式(推导式) >>>[num for hang in nums for num in hang] [1,2,3,4,5,6,7,8,9] 二、双重循环 >>>res=[] >>>for hang in nums: >>>fornuminhang: ...